The red wine Pugnitello IGT, vintage 2012 from the winery Cantina LaSelva has been rated in 2016 by Othmar Kiem with 91 Falstaff points. It is a wine made from the grape variety Aglianico from the region Maremma in Italy.

Tasting Notes

91
Tasting from 13.10.2016: Othmar Kiem

Rich, impenetrable ruby-violet. Fleshy and dense on the nose, full of tobacco, blackberries and ripe plums. Hearty and gripping on the attack, opens with fleshy fruit, lots of dense tannins with sweet melting, fine spicy notes on the finish.
